Came across this "Mars Bar Advert" in a copy of the Daily Mail from Wednesday June 7th 1944.
Look at the wording.. " ZONING now re-stricts Mars to the Southern Counties" ..

Thought that Food Ration Books would prevent most people from buying a Mars Bar in WW2.

"Murray Walker is often the man credited with coining the slogan "A Mars a Day Helps You Work, Rest and Play", although he denied he created what became arguably Britain's most recognisable advertising slogan. Mr Walker was an account director in charge of the Mars business at the advertising agency where the slogan was coined in 1959."
